Where have you seen this before?

Remember John Madden’s commentary on Remember John Madden’s commentary on NFL games?NFL games?

The Telestrator he used was a conducive film The Telestrator he used was a conducive film overlay on a television monitor, an early overlay on a television monitor, an early form of an electronic whiteboard.form of an electronic whiteboard.

It is also on display and open to public use at It is also on display and open to public use at Walt Disney’s EPCOT Center.Walt Disney’s EPCOT Center.

History and Evolution of Electronic Whiteboards Leonard Reiffel, an electronics prodigy, is Leonard Reiffel, an electronics prodigy, is

credited with its inventioncredited with its invention Reiffel revised the Telestator he created into Reiffel revised the Telestator he created into

the Discon teleconferencing system, which the Discon teleconferencing system, which he introduced to the business world in 1981he introduced to the business world in 1981

As businesses adopted the Discon and its As businesses adopted the Discon and its variations by competitors, educators began variations by competitors, educators began to imagine its use in academiato imagine its use in academia

History and Evolution of Electronic Whiteboards In 1998, Georgia Tech adopted and initiated In 1998, Georgia Tech adopted and initiated

a project created by part if its College of a project created by part if its College of Computing and Graphics, Visualization and Computing and Graphics, Visualization and Usability CenterUsability Center This Classroom 2000 project had a This Classroom 2000 project had a

primary goal of providing electronic primary goal of providing electronic whiteboards in all campus classrooms whiteboards in all campus classrooms

Growing Popularity of Electronic Whiteboards In October 2003, the Thomaston-Upson In October 2003, the Thomaston-Upson

County School District in rural Georgia County School District in rural Georgia became the first reported public school became the first reported public school system to install electronic whiteboards in system to install electronic whiteboards in every district K-12 classroomevery district K-12 classroom

What does it Cost?

Costs vary widely depending upon the product, its Costs vary widely depending upon the product, its functions, and the manufacturerfunctions, and the manufacturer

Examples:Examples: Graphics tablets can be as little as $100Graphics tablets can be as little as $100 SmartBoard, one of the most inclusive of SmartBoard, one of the most inclusive of

functions useful in academic settings, sells a functions useful in academic settings, sells a basic unit for $1600basic unit for $1600

Several mid-range products and accessories Several mid-range products and accessories range form $600 to over $2000range form $600 to over $2000
